veskforge-showcase


veskforge is an unofficial desktop build manager for Vesktop users who want custom Vencord plugins without hand-running the source workflow every time. it manages a Vencord checkout, installs enabled plugins into src/userplugins, builds Vencord, validates the desktop dist, and points Vesktop at that build through Vesktop's supported vencordDir state setting.

why

Vencord custom plugins are compile-time plugins. Vesktop loads a built Vencord desktop bundle, so the stable workflow is to build a custom Vencord dist and configure Vesktop to use it.

  • keeps to Vesktop's supported custom Vencord location instead of patching installed app files
  • supports local plugin files, local plugin folders, and Git plugin sources
  • stores plugin state in one manifest and recreates src/userplugins from that manifest before each build
  • validates required Vencord desktop artifacts before touching Vesktop state
  • preserves unrelated Vesktop state.json fields when applying vencordDir
  • can start with the OS session and check the managed Vencord checkout for updates
  • defaults updates to manual apply, with explicit opt-in for startup rebuild/apply automation

requirements

requirementneeded fornotes
Windows or Linuxrunning veskforgeWindows releases include installer builds. Linux releases include .deb, .rpm, and AppImage builds.
Vesktopapplying buildsveskforge writes Vesktop's vencordDir setting; it does not patch Vesktop binaries.
Gitbuilding custom Vencordused to clone/update Vencord and Git plugin sources.
Node.jsbuilding custom Vencordinstall the normal Node.js distribution that includes Corepack and npm.
pnpmbuilding custom Vencordveskforge detects normal PATH installs plus common Windows locations such as %APPDATA%\\npm, %LOCALAPPDATA%\\pnpm, Volta, Scoop, and Node.js folders.
trusted custom pluginsevery buildplugin code runs as application code; veskforge does not sandbox plugins.
Rust toolchainbuilding veskforge from source onlynot needed when using release downloads.

workflow

stepbehavior
add pluginpaste or drop a local source file, local plugin folder, or HTTPS GitHub repo after validating the Vencord plugin entrypoint
buildclone or update Vendicated/Vencord, recreate src/userplugins, run pnpm install --frozen-lockfile, then pnpm build
validaterequire vencordDesktopMain.js, vencordDesktopPreload.js, vencordDesktopRenderer.js, vencordDesktopRenderer.css
applywrite the validated dist path to Vesktop state.json as vencordDir
startup checkoptionally launch at login, check the managed Vencord checkout, and rebuild/apply only when Auto rebuild is enabled
restartfully restart Vesktop so it loads the custom Vencord build

architecture

veskforge keeps the risky parts explicit: plugin sources are validated before they enter the managed Vencord checkout, and Vesktop state is only updated after a desktop build produces the expected artifacts.

plugin sources

sourceexpected shape
local file.ts, .tsx, .js, or .jsx Vencord module with a default export; simple .plugin.js files without BdApi usage can be wrapped at build time
local folderfolder containing index.ts, index.tsx, index.js, index.jsx, or exactly one .plugin.js; veskforge can auto-detect one nested plugin folder
GitHub repohttps://github.com/owner/repo, with optional branch, tag, or commit ref; veskforge clones and auto-detects one plugin folder

veskforge recreates the managed Vencord src/userplugins folder from the manifest on each build. disabled plugins stay in the manifest but are not materialized into the next build. see plugin source formats for supported and rejected source shapes.

paths

veskforge stores its own state in the platform app data directory. the managed Vencord checkout lives under that app data directory at:

workspace/Vencord

Vesktop state detection checks common locations such as:

platformcandidate
linux~/.config/vesktop/state.json
linux flatpak~/.var/app/dev.vencord.Vesktop/config/vesktop/state.json
windows%APPDATA%\\vesktop\\state.json

you can also paste a state.json path in the app, or set VESKTOP_STATE_FILE before launching veskforge.

update model

veskforge defaults to manual updates. the app can check whether the managed Vencord checkout differs from origin/main; rebuilding is an explicit action unless Auto rebuild is enabled in settings.

Start at login registers veskforge with the OS session startup mechanism. On launch, veskforge checks the managed Vencord checkout. If Auto rebuild is off, it only reports the update. If Auto rebuild is on, it rebuilds the custom Vencord bundle and reapplies the validated dist to the detected Vesktop state.json.

this is intentional. Vencord and Discord internals can change, and a plugin that built yesterday may fail after an upstream update.
